Output 5d89af6e35fd185a606d8cb1df1f9937fc2c863ee03a0bc97552388a7769e4d8:1

value
79950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e2830521e38db30eadc43fd4d4bf7708f20f634 OP_EQUAL
address
37MfxoPzDiyaoNe1HVT4XBuoyGmqA8gox5
transaction
5d89af6e35fd185a606d8cb1df1f9937fc2c863ee03a0bc97552388a7769e4d8
confirmations
390571
spent
true